Por: Eng. Leivan de Carvalho
Segurança




   Integridade     Autenticidade




Software Assurance
Software Assurance
O nível de confiança de que o software está livre de vulnerabilidades,
quer sejam intencionais ou acidentalmente inseridas em qualquer
momento durante seu ciclo de vida; e de que o software funciona da
maneira pretendida.
Segurança
• Princípios Seguros de Análise
• Práticas Seguras de Desenvolvimento
• Testes de Segurança
Spring Security




Framework de autenticação e controlo de acesso

Versão actual: Spring Security 3.1.0.RELEASE
Demonstração
• Etapas
  – Projecto Biblioteca
     • Elaborar Modelo de Dados
     • Adicionar bibliotecas
           – Spring 3.0.6
           – Spring Security 3.1.0.RELEASE
           – Log4J
     • Criação dos EJBs e SpringBeans
     • Configuração do Web.xml
     • Configuração do ApplicationContext
  – Projecto Kuzola
     • Gestão de Utilizadores
Fontes
• http://static.springsource.org/spring-
  security/site
• http://refcardz.dzone.com/
• http://www.safecode.org/

Software Assurance - A Spring Security Demonstration

  • 1.
    Por: Eng. Leivande Carvalho
  • 2.
    Segurança Integridade Autenticidade Software Assurance
  • 3.
    Software Assurance O nívelde confiança de que o software está livre de vulnerabilidades, quer sejam intencionais ou acidentalmente inseridas em qualquer momento durante seu ciclo de vida; e de que o software funciona da maneira pretendida.
  • 4.
    Segurança • Princípios Segurosde Análise • Práticas Seguras de Desenvolvimento • Testes de Segurança
  • 5.
    Spring Security Framework deautenticação e controlo de acesso Versão actual: Spring Security 3.1.0.RELEASE
  • 6.
    Demonstração • Etapas – Projecto Biblioteca • Elaborar Modelo de Dados • Adicionar bibliotecas – Spring 3.0.6 – Spring Security 3.1.0.RELEASE – Log4J • Criação dos EJBs e SpringBeans • Configuração do Web.xml • Configuração do ApplicationContext – Projecto Kuzola • Gestão de Utilizadores
  • 7.
    Fontes • http://static.springsource.org/spring- security/site • http://refcardz.dzone.com/ • http://www.safecode.org/